What is Mulesoft?
Mulesoft is a software company that provides the Integration platform to guide Businesses to connect data, devices, and applications on many cloud computing platforms. It is known as Any point platform.
It contains tools to update and handle, test application programming interfaces. Known as API, that supports this type of connections.
In 2018, Mulesoft acquired by Salesforce, known as software as a service. So, Mulesoft is part of the salesforce Integration platform and cloud.
Now we will discuss the components that present in Mulesoft.
It is known as multi-tenant Integration Platform like ipaas. So, cloud hub provided as managed service, that means it is a development team, that do not have to install or operate.
Visualizer is known as a graphical tool to navigate the API and their equals in real-time.
Monitoring is a dashboard that guides you to monitor application.
Exchange is a centralized hub for development team used to store and access API, documentation, connectors, templates, and many more.
Run-time Manager is a central console from which a developer can check all the resources moved on to the Anytime platform on so many hybrid cloud architectures.
Analytics at any-point analytics tool used to map the API metrics, like performance and usage. Therefore, A developer can use this tool to design dashboards and charts to see the API performance and to recognize the main cause for performance problems.
Connectors are known as a set of built-in connectors that a developer used to integrate applications with third-party SOAP and REST.
it's a graphical and Java Based Environment, a developer used to move API to the cloud environments. Similarly, Studio also has features to guide, edit, built and debug the Data Integrations in any point platform.
[ Related Article - Explain Mulesoft any point studio ? ]
That is a dashboard by which a developer will handle and manage APIs and sources via the API gateway. With this component of the Mulesoft Anypoint dashboard. However, It is possible that we can handle user access to many APIs. So, start secure connections to back end data sources and Design policies on API acceleration and calls.
[ More information at - Designing API in Mulesoft ]
it's an online tool that developer can implement to design and make an API, and as well as share an API and share that design with the team members. So, the developer can also reuse some special components of an API like the security schema.
Mulesoft is from San Francisco and founded by Ross Mason in the year 2006. The name itself shows that the work of mulesoft ESB is to eliminate the donkey work. As a matter of fact mule basically is a combination of hybrid horses and donkeys. Not to mention the company selected the name exactly to show its platform capability.
According to Mulesoft, up to 2018 July, it has 1200 customers include lymphoma society, leukemia, Asics, wells Fargo, Siemens.
To get in-depth knowledge on Mulesoft, you can enroll for live Mulesoft training by OnlineITGuru with 24/7 support and lifetime access
Generally, it's a lightweight and highly scalable, It allows you to initiate small and connected to more applications. Therefore the ESB manages every interaction between components and applications. For instance, they will exist in the same Internet or same virtual machine, without any connection of inbuilt transport protocol.
To illustrate we have many ESB implementations on the market. In that many of them offer less functionality or a messaging server or application server, that locks you into a specific vendor. We already know that mulesoft is neutral vendor company, so different vendor implementations can go into it. In the meantime when you use a mule, we never lock to a specific vendor.
Advantages of Mulesoft
Especially Mulesoft components like being anything that you want. You can easily go and integrate from a simple java project, with another type of framework. Almost ESB and Mule Instances can start significant component Reuse. Hence, Messages can be in any form like binary to SOAP, images files and many more. Mule does not force any type of design ups and downs on the architecture like XML messaging and WSDL service contracts.
For Instance, You can move mule in any type of topological, that not known as ESB. It is an embeddable and lightweight software. maybe, It dramatically decreases time to market and increases productivity for projects to offer scalable and secure applications.
So I have completed our what is mulesoft blog, in upcoming blogs, I will write more about Mule ESB and it features.
OnlineITGuru is providing best Mulesoft training with 24/7 support and get certified in all Mulesoft IT Certifications